The Royals won the BIG GAME. George Kottaras took a walk with the bases loaded to give the Royals the lead in the 10th. Then Alex Gordon put the game away with a Grand Slam.
Notes
- James Shields pitched effectively allowing 5 hits, 3 walks, 4 strikeouts over 8 innings. Also he had 3 wild pitches which helped to contribute to a run in the 4th.
- From the 6th inning on, the Royal pitchers didn't allow a base runner.
- Chris Getz was the only starter to not get on base.
- Huge collision at home between Fielder and Perez.
- Moustakas got an extra base hit. It is his 3rd of the season.
- Verlander wasn't himself. He allow 8 hits and only struck out 4 batters. He left the game with cracked skin on his thumb.
- Gordon is the hacker of the game by only seeing 17 pitches in 6 PA.
